A suitable position for the discharge point is ideally below
a fixed grating and above the water seal in a trapped gully.
Downward discharges at low level, i.e. up to 100 mm above
external surfaces such as car parks, hard standings, grassed
areas, etc. are acceptable providing that where children may
play or otherwise come into contact with discharges a wire
cage or similar guard is positioned to prevent contact, whilst
maintaining visibility.
Do not fit any valves or taps to the discharge pipework.
Ensure the pipework has at least 1:200 fall continuously from
the tundish to the discharge point.
The discharge pipe from the pressure relief valve of the boiler
may be tee'd into the discharge pipework from the Glow-worm
downstream of the tundish in the horizontal pipework.
4.5 High Level Termination
Providing that the point of termination is such that persons
in or around the building will not be endangered should
discharge take place, the method of termination shown in
diagram 4.2 is satisfactory.
Examples of points to consider when deciding whether a
location for the high level discharge is suitable are:
1.
The possibility, taking into account wind effect, that
someone may be in the path of the water being discharged
and if so, whether the temperature of the discharge water will
have been sufficiently reduced to not be dangerous. Thermal
conductivity of the structure’s surface, climatic conditions and
location and orientation of the discharge pipe may or may not
have an effect on reducing the temperature of the discharge
water.
2.
The location of windows and similar openings.
3.
The likelihood of a pram being left beneath the point of
discharge.
4.
The ability of the structures surface to withstand near
boiling water.
5.
The possibility of ice formation if water is discharged onto
pedestrian walkways.
